In the realm of baking bread, the Dutch oven shines due to its heavy-duty design, which evenly distributes heat and creates the perfect crust. One of the most popular applications is sourdough bread. The controlled steaming inside the pot produces a crust that's crispy on the outside while keeping the inside soft and chewy. Healthy Artisan Bread in Five Minutes a Day by Jeff Hertzberg and Zoe François cites the Dutch oven as a game-changer for home bread bakers looking for professional-quality results. Another delightful recipe that's worth trying is Dutch oven cinnamon rolls. By prepping the dough ahead of time and allowing it to rise overnight, these rolls bake up fluffy and gooey. The pot’s consistent heat promotes even baking, ensuring that each roll is perfectly cooked. Studies have shown that using a Dutch oven can enhance flavor development, as the heat retention encourages caramelization of sugars and the Maillard reaction.

For dessert lovers, a Dutch oven is also perfect for baking cakes and cobblers. Imagine a juicy peach cobbler with a golden brown biscuit topping. The Dutch oven’s lid traps moisture, keeping the fruit filling luscious. A cake, on the other hand, will bake with a tender crumb due to the pot's even heat distribution. Experts suggest using a parchment paper liner for cakes to ensure a smooth release and professional appearance. Those keen on savory dishes will find the Dutch oven equally accommodating. It can be used for a range of savory pies, including chicken pot pie and quiche. The oven’s depth allows for generous fillings and tall, flaky crusts. Additionally, baking a deep-dish pizza in a Dutch oven can yield exceptional results, with a crust that's both chewy and crisp.what can you bake in a dutch oven
Professionals in the culinary industry often recommend cast iron Dutch ovens for their superior heat retention and distribution properties. Brands like Le Creuset and Lodge are frequently cited for their durability and performance. It’s advised to preheat the Dutch oven before adding your ingredients to mimic the conditions of a traditional baking oven. This method helps in achieving optimal cooking temperatures and textures. Beyond the recipes, maintaining your Dutch oven is crucial for consistent results. Regular seasoning, especially for cast iron varieties, is essential to prevent sticking and protect the pot from rusting. Thorough cleaning and cautious handling ensure that your Dutch oven remains a reliable companion for years.
